Nylon-PA is a common example of a polymer known as polyamide, which contains monomers joined by peptide bonds. Many variants of polyamide nylon exist and exhibit different properties, but generally speaking this thermoplastic material is rigid, translucent, has a long service life, and is creep and wear resistant. Lightweight, yet heavy duty, Nylon-PA is most suitable for applications involving toxic chemicals, high humidity levels, and extreme temperature conditions.
